I have been using current stable gregorio version 3.0.3 on an Ubuntu 14.04 LTS based TeXLive 2015 ("vanilla") system since quite a while w/o any problems. Unfortunately, the latest TeXLive updates (October '15) obtained thru std tlmgr update seem to cause strange incompatibilities preventing lualatex+se/gregoriotex to compile any more. Attempts to compile original std examples (PopulusSion.gabc, main-lualatex.tex) result in a strange error:

! I can't find file `['.
<to be read again>
\relax
l.44 \includescore[
                 a]{PopulusSion}
(For more details pls see bottom of this note)

Due to a couple of stepwise update/restore attempts I can't but conclude that the 'bad guy' must be among these Oct'15 updates:

   latex                  [12591k]: local:    37789, source:    38531
   luamplib                 [195k]: local:    38019, source:    38538
   luatexbase               [270k]: local:    30562, source:    38550
   luatexko                 [247k]: local:    37775, source:    38540
   texlive-docindex         [214k]: local:    38492, source:    38552
   texlive-msg-translations [110k]: local:    37957, source:    38534
   texlive-scripts           [87k]: local:    38469, source:    38543
   ctablestack              [152k]: local: <absent>, source:    38514
   dynamicnumber            [162k]: local: <absent>, source:    38549
   fibeamer                [1194k]: local: <absent>, source:    38548
   collection-genericextra    [1k]: local:    37591, source:    38503
   collection-latexextra      [5k]: local:    38408, source:    38549
   collection-luatex          [1k]: local:    37811, source:    38514

In particular, the latex update (in conjunction w/ the luatexbase update ?) may be responsible for the trouble: it seems to introduce some major changes in 'luatex and catcode business' (which I do not understand much about, but Elie for sure, will ;-) ) and it enforces regenerating formats .
